Synthroid? - March 9th 2010, 08:34 PM

I've been on the medication for a little over a week. It's actually making me kind of more tired than usual. Am I on a high enough dosage you think? Or should I wait 2 or three more weeks?

Hey there Holly,

If you're taking it for the main purpose of the medication, I really think you should mention this to your doctor. Though, the website does mention taking about 2 weeks for noticeable effects to occur, I'm assuming it should be having the opposite effect to what you described.

Quote:
Signs of not getting enough medication:

clumsiness
coldness
constipation
dry, puffy skin
listlessness
muscle aches
sleepiness
tiredness
weakness
weight gain
My suggestion is coming from that specific portion of the site. If you are feeling any of these things, which you said you are, I think it would be in your best interest to talk to your doctor when you can. It might be a sign that this medication needs to be increased in order for the desired results to occur.
